What Is a Design Build Contract?

Design build is a construction management method where a unified entity handles both the drafting and engineering and the actual building of your home. Different from the traditional fragmented model, design build means you have one point of contact responsible for the entire scope, from land evaluation and architectural drawings through structural work and interior completion.

Mechanically, the design build workflow works by integrating the design and construction phases so they overlap and inform each other rather than operating in silos. A Brother & Brother Builders design build team brings together licensed architects, project planners, and trade partners who meet regularly. This results in the fact that if a design detail is outside budget, it gets adjusted immediately rather than becoming a mid-build problem.

The design build approach is especially powerful for complex residential projects because all selections — from window placement to roofline details — is assessed through both a creative eye and a practical building viewpoint at simultaneously. The payoff is a home that matches the original concept and is built efficiently.

The Design Build Journey From Start to Finish

  1. Initial Consultation and Vision Discovery

    The design build journey starts with a thorough conversation about your goals for the home. Our team discusses your how you live, priority spaces, site characteristics, and budget range. This meeting lays the groundwork for every decision that follows.

  2. Assessing Your Land

    Before a single line is drawn, our design build team reviews the lot for grading requirements, utility access, municipal regulations, and drainage patterns. This analysis ensures that architectural choices are based on actual conditions.

  3. Creating the Initial Design

    With property information in hand, our architects and designers produce early floor plans that map out your home. The schematic phase includes rough massing, interior flow, and initial finish direction. Pricing is evaluated at this stage so that the concept fits within your investment parameters.

  4. Design Development and Engineering

    When the early plans get a green light, the design build firm deepens the plans into fully engineered documents. Engineering elements, systems design, exterior envelope details, and product choices are all finalized during this phase. The field crew leaders check the plans before they leave our office.

  5. Pulling Permits and Preparing to Build

    Our design build team coordinates all submittals with local building departments on your behalf. While permits are being processed, we finalize the construction schedule, source key products, and brief all subcontractors. This overlap saves weeks compared to the traditional approach.

  6. The Construction Phase

    With permits in hand, the build starts. Brother & Brother Builders self-performs a substantial portion of the work, and our project managers coordinate all trade partners on a structured timeline. Scheduled client site visits keep you informed as your home comes together.

  7. Final Inspections, Punch List, and Delivery

    In the final weeks of the build, our team conducts a detailed punch list inspection alongside you. Each outstanding task is addressed before you take possession. Final inspections are coordinated by our office, and we are here to help for any post-move questions after completion.

Design Build FAQ

How long does a design build project generally last?

Design through delivery, a design build new home in San Jose typically takes 14 to 20 months depending on home complexity. More straightforward homes on graded properties may finish closer to ten to twelve months, while more complex builds with extensive custom millwork may run toward the longer end.

What does design build usually price out at for a new home in San Jose?

Custom home builds in the greater Bay Area market generally start from $400 to $700 or more per square foot depending on specification tier, ground conditions, and the scope of the build. The design build method limits financial surprises read more because pricing is integrated during the planning process rather than only at the end.

What choices do homeowners need to make early in the design build process?

Important upfront choices include overall square footage and room count, exterior architectural style, materials tier, and custom elements like outdoor living structures. Making these decisions clearly early in design helps the design build team to estimate costs with confidence and meet the build calendar.

How does design build manage changes mid-project?

Since both design and field staff work together, field modifications are assessed fast for cost impact and priced honestly. While fewer unexpected changes occur in a design build engagement compared to conventional delivery, changes initiated by the homeowner are always possible and will be handled through a clear modification process.

Does design build apply for smaller lots in established areas?

Yes. Design build is often especially valuable on constrained sites because the integrated team can solve site problems before breaking ground rather than finding issues mid-build. Tight lots in San Jose commonly present drainage requirements that benefit from coordinated architectural and structural collaboration.
